Subject: Scaler 2.6 is out the door

Hi support folks — quick heads up that the Pantryline recipe-scaling calculator just shipped version 2.6. The big one: fractional cup conversions no longer round weirdly when scaling below 0.5x, which should kill most of those "my half batch needs 0.33 eggs" tickets. Metric toggles also persist between sessions now. If a customer reports odd scaling, ask which version they're on and compare against the build token below.

pipeline stamp: htk9_6ce9d33c5

Subject: Key rotation — Ledgerline FX service

Team: rotating the Ledgerline key today. Context for the sync: the rounding-error fix in currency conversion (banker's rounding now applied consistently at the minor-unit step) shipped last night, and the rotation invalidates cached clients still on the buggy path. Old key dies at 17:00. Update staging configs first, prod after the sync. Reconciliation reports should show zero drift by tomorrow's run. New key is below.

API key for kafop-fafof: qvz3-4pw

### Escalation: Log Compaction (Burrowpipe MQ)

If compaction on a Burrowpipe broker stalls for more than 30 minutes, don't just restart it — you'll likely orphan segment files. First check disk headroom and the compactor lag metric on the Pinewhistle dashboard. If lag keeps climbing after a manual compaction kick, escalate to the Queue Platform folks; they own the compactor and can pause producers safely. Ping them in chat first, then follow up at the address below.

alerts address for kajog-tadup: druox@plorvanet.internal